A New York mesothelioma attorney has the expertise required to handle all kinds of asbestos claims including lawsuits against employers and manufacturers who are accountable for the victim's asbestos exposure. These claims can include personal injury or wrongful death cases. In New York, plaintiffs have three years to file an action for personal injury or wrongful death after the diagnosis of mesothelioma. In an asbestos lawsuit lawyers could claim that the asbestos producers violated the state's product liability laws by knowingly selling dangerous products. They could also claim that the firms failed to provide adequate warnings or otherwise comply with safety standards of the industry. They may also seek punitive damages, which are designed to punish the companies and deter others from engaging in similar behavior. A New York mesothelioma lawyer can aid asbestos patients to compile and review the documents they require to demonstrate their case. This includes medical documents, wage records, building records, and other sources of evidence. They can identify witnesses and experts, and ensure that all the required documents are filed with the appropriate authorities. They can determine if a person is entitled to compensation from asbestos trusts that were established by the bankrupt asbestos producers. They can also file a wrongful-death lawsuit on behalf family members who died from asbestos-related cancers like mesothelioma, among others. Cost The law firm you choose to handle the mesothelioma case should be affordable and accessible. Many asbestos lawyers operate on a basis of contingency fees that means they do not get paid unless you win your case. These firms will also advance all costs related to your case, and will only get these costs back from the settlement funds you receive. They will also keep all your personal information private, and will not share it with anyone, not even the defendants in your lawsuit. Asbestos, a deadly and dangerous substance, causes many kinds of cancers, including mesothelioma. It can affect the lining of the lungs (pleural mesothelioma), stomach (peritoneal mesothelioma), and heart (pericardial mesothelioma). It is usually diagnosed in people who have been exposed to asbestos. Mesothelioma patients often have a complicated legal background. They may have worked in various industries and have many asbestos exposure sites. This makes determining the source of their exposure difficult, particularly since some companies that used asbestos have gone under and do not exist anymore. To be compensated, victims must bring an action for personal injury or wrongful deaths against the asbestos-related company which exposed them.
